How to Play Sudoku
Fill a 9 × 9 grid so that every row, every column and every 3 × 3 box contains the digits 1 to 9 exactly once. The digits printed at the start are fixed clues. A properly built sudoku has exactly one solution and can always be reached by deduction, never by guessing.
The rules, step by step
- 1Fill every cell with 1 to 9The grid has 81 cells. When it is full and legal, the puzzle is solved.
- 2No repeats in a rowEach of the nine rows must contain every digit from 1 to 9 exactly once.
- 3No repeats in a columnThe same applies down each of the nine columns.
- 4No repeats in a boxEach of the nine 3 × 3 boxes must also contain 1 to 9 exactly once.
- 5Clues are fixedThe digits present at the start are part of the puzzle and cannot be changed.

Where do you start a sudoku?
- 1Find the fullest boxLook for the 3 × 3 box with the most clues. It has the fewest possibilities and usually gives up a digit immediately.
- 2Scan one digit at a timeTake the digit that appears most often in the clues. For each box that does not have it, cross out the rows and columns where it already sits. If one cell survives, it is a hidden single.
- 3Fill in the naked singlesAny cell whose row, column and box already contain eight different digits has only one possible value.
- 4Pencil in the restWhen scanning stops producing digits, write candidates into the empty cells and look for pairs.
What techniques come after singles?
- Naked pair — two cells in a unit share the same two candidates, so no other cell in that unit can hold either digit.
- Hidden pair — two digits that can only go in the same two cells of a unit; everything else can be erased from those cells.
- Pointing pair — a digit confined to one row within a box can be eliminated from the rest of that row.
- Box-line reduction — the same argument in reverse, from a row or column into a box.
How do you win more often?
- Scan for hidden singles by digit, not by cellPick a digit, look at each box, and cross off the rows and columns where it already appears. Very often exactly one cell survives — that is faster than examining cells one at a time.
- Pencil in a whole box at a timeCandidates are only useful when they are complete. Half-filled pencil marks lead to false deductions.
- Look for pairs before triplesTwo cells in a unit with the same two candidates lock those digits out of every other cell in that unit. It is the cheapest technique beyond singles and it unlocks most hard puzzles.
- Work the most-constrained unitThe row, column or box with the fewest empty cells is where the next deduction almost always is.
Common questions about sudoku
- Can a sudoku have more than one solution?
- A valid sudoku cannot. If a grid admits two solutions it is not a sudoku, and no amount of logic will settle the ambiguous cells.
- Is sudoku a maths puzzle?
- Not really. The digits are just nine distinct symbols — you could play with nine colours and nothing would change. It is a constraint-satisfaction puzzle, not arithmetic.
